I've been playing this song on guitar for a little bit. For those wondering, no; it thankfully does not having any of the squished, badly charted wankery that was present in the last pack. Here is how I would sort the top three hardest parts:

1. Presentation
This has what is by far the suite's hardest solo. The hardest individual part within it is a sweep pattern that - while one-hand-able - is very awkward. There's some odd HO/PO patterns throughout the remainder of the solo.

2. Grand Finale
This part has the medley's second hardest solo as you can might have already deduced, which is immediately apparent right when it starts, as there is fairly awkward pattern with strummed notes tossed in. There's also odd strumming patterns all throughout the portion preceding it and just before the ending.

3. Overture
Most of this song actually isn't too bad (heck, even the solo isn't that difficult), but the odd strumming patterns towards the end of this part make it kind of a pain in the ass to get an FC past.

Available on Xbox 360 on 12/31/11, PS3 and Wii on 01/03/12:
  • 2112 by Rush (X) (360 and PS3 Only)

  • 2112: Discovery, Presentation by Rush (X)

  • 2112: Oracle: The Dream, Soliloquy, Grand Finale by Rush (X)

  • 2112: Overture, The Temples Of Syrinx by Rush (X)

(These tracks will be available in Europe on PlayStation®3 system January 18th)

The tracks will be available as “Rush ‘2112’”with all tracks available for purchase individually on Xbox 360, PlayStation®3 system and Wii™. Tracks marked with “X” will offer Pro Guitar and Pro Bass expansions for $0.99 per song. The 20 minute medley is not available as a single, it is only available in the pack.

Price:

$5.49 USD, £2.49 UK, €3.99 EU (440 Microsoft Points, 550 Wii Points™) for the “Rush ‘2112’” pack
$1.99 USD, £.99 UK, €1.49 EU (160 Microsoft Points, 200 Wii Points™) per song
$0.99 USD (100 Wii Points™/80 Microsoft Points), £0.59 UK, €0.79 EU per song for eligible Pro Guitar/Pro Bass upgrade

Not that anyone cares, but the Hard guitar chart has 2,148 notes which is the highest of any Rock Band hard guitar chart. It is also (to the best of my knowledge) the first and only Rock Band hard guitar chart with a possible score of over 500,000 points.
